
3. Spicy Avocado Hummus
If you think hummus can’t get any better, think again! This Spicy Avocado Hummus combines the creamy texture of avocado with the classic chickpea base of traditional hummus. The addition of jalapeño gives it a kick that will have your guests coming back for more.
- 1 can of chickpeas, drained and rinsed
- 1 ripe avocado
- 2 tablespoons tahini
- 1 clove garlic
- 1-2 jalapeños, seeded and chopped (adjust for heat)
- Juice of 1 lime
- Salt to taste
- Olive oil for drizzling
To make the hummus, simply blend all the ingredients in a food processor until smooth. If the mixture is too thick, add a bit of water or olive oil until you reach your desired consistency. Serve it with pita chips or fresh veggies for a delightful treat!
4. Creamy Spinach and Artichoke Dip
This Creamy Spinach and Artichoke Dip is a classic crowd-pleaser that never fails to impress. Its rich, cheesy flavor and warm, gooey texture make it the perfect comfort food for any gathering. Best served hot, this dip is sure to disappear quickly!
- 1 cup frozen spinach, thawed and drained
- 1 can artichoke hearts, drained and chopped
- 1 cup cream cheese, softened
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
To prepare, mix all the ingredients in a bowl until well combined. Transfer to a baking dish and bake at 350°F (175°C) for about 25-30 minutes or until bubbly and golden on top. Serve it warm with tortilla chips, baguette slices, or fresh vegetable sticks.
5. Roasted Red Pepper and Feta Dip
If you want something a bit different, try this Roasted Red Pepper and Feta Dip. It’s tangy, smoky, and full of flavor. Plus, it’s incredibly easy to whip up, making it ideal for last-minute gatherings.
- 1 cup roasted red peppers, chopped
- 1/2 cup feta cheese
- 1/4 cup cream cheese, softened
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 clove garlic
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- Salt and pepper to taste
Blend all the ingredients in a food processor until smooth. You can serve this dip cold or warm it in the oven for a few minutes before serving. It pairs wonderfully with pita bread, crackers, or fresh veggies.
6. Buffalo Chicken Dip
For those who love a bit of heat, Buffalo Chicken Dip is a must-try! This dip combines shredded chicken with spicy buffalo sauce, cream cheese, and cheese for a spicy, creamy delight that’s perfect for game day or any casual get-together.
- 2 cups shredded cooked chicken
- 1/2 cup cream cheese, softened
- 1/2 cup ranch dressing
- 1/2 cup buffalo sauce
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up crumbled blue cheese (optional)
Combine all the ingredients in a mixing bowl. Spread the mixture into a baking dish and bake at 350°F (175°C) for 20-25 minutes, until bubbly. Serve with celery sticks, tortilla chips, or crackers for an unforgettable spicy treat!
7. Mediterranean Bean Dip
This Mediterranean Bean Dip is fresh, healthy, and packed with flavor. It’s a great alternative to heavier dips, making it perfect for those looking for lighter options without sacrificing taste.
- 1 can cannellini beans, drained and rinsed
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 1 clove garlic
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Blend the beans, ol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, oregano, salt, and pepper in a food processor until smooth. Drizzle with a bit more olive oil and garnish with fresh parsley before serving. This dip pairs beautifully with pita bread or fresh veggies.
8. Chunky Tomato Salsa
No gathering is complete without a good salsa, and this Chunky Tomato Salsa is both refreshing and flavorful. It’s a versatile dip that can be served with tortilla chips, on tacos, or even as a topping for grilled meats!
- 4 ripe tomatoes, diced
- 1/2 red onion, finely chopped
- 1 jalapeño, seeded and chopped
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
- Juice of 1 lime
- Salt to taste
Combine all the ingredients in a bowl and let it sit for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ld together. This salsa is fresh, vibrant, and a guaranteed hit at any gathering!
9. Sweet Potato and Black Bean Dip
This Sweet Potato and Black Bean Dip is not only delicious but also packed with nutrients. It’s a unique twist on traditional dips that is perfect for those who enjoy a bit of sweetness along with savory flavors.
- 1 large sweet potato, peeled and cubed
- 1 can black be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tablespoon lime juice
Boil the sweet potato until tender, then drain and mash it in a bowl. Add the black beans, cumin, chili powder, salt, pepper, and lime juice. Mix well until combined. Serve with tortilla chips or fresh veggies. This dip is hearty and satisfying!
10. Classic Guacamole
No list of dip recipes would be complete without the beloved guacamole. Simple yet packed with flavor, it’s a must-have for any gathering and is incredibly easy to make.
- 2 ripe avocados
- 1 small onion, finely chopped
- 1 tomato, diced
- 1 lime, juiced
- Salt to taste
- Fresh cilantro, chopped (optional)
In a bowl, mash the avocados and then mix in the onion, tomato, lime juice, and salt. For added flavor, throw in some chopped cilantro if desired. Serve immediately with tortilla chips or as a topping for your favorite Mexican dishes.

Storing Leftover Dips
If you find yourself with leftover dips, here’s how to store them properly:
- Air-tight Containers: Store your dips in air-tight containers to maintain freshness. This will help prevent them from drying out or absorbing other odors in the fridge.
- Consume Quickly: Most dips can be stored in the fridge for 3-5 days. Make sure to consume them within this timeframe for the best taste and safety.
- Freezing Options: Some dips, like bean dips or cheesy dips, can be frozen for longer storage. Just ensure to thaw them in the fridge before serving.
